H-1B sponsorship profile: University of North Texas Health Science Center. Across U.S. Department of Labor LCA disclosures, University of North Texas Health Science Center filed 31 Labor Condition Applications covering 31 H-1B worker positions between fiscal year 2023 and fiscal year 2026. The employer’s DOL certification rate sits at 100% (31 certified of 31 filed), a useful proxy for how cleanly their prevailing-wage attestations pass the Labor Department’s preliminary review before USCIS adjudication.
Compensation spread. Offered wages on University of North Texas Health Science Center’s H-1B petitions range from $38,316 at the low end to $175,008 at the high end, with a petition-weighted average of $87,811. That range reflects the mix of occupations the company sponsors, led by Assistant Professor (9 petitions at $115,121 avg), followed by Research Scientist and Research Assistant. H-1B salaries reported on LCAs must meet or exceed the DOL prevailing wage for the role and worksite, so the spread also tracks wage-level geography and seniority.
Geographic footprint. University of North Texas Health Science Center is headquartered in Fort Worth, TX under NAICS code 611310, and places H-1B workers across 1 state, most heavily in TX. Most frequently sponsored job titles at University of North Texas Health Science Center
| Job Title | Petitions | Avg. Salary |
|---|---|---|
| Assistant Professor | 9 | $115,121 |
| Research Scientist | 4 | $76,668 |
| Research Assistant | 4 | $47,763 |
| Postdoctoral Research Associate | 4 | $58,996 |
| Associate Professor | 3 | $153,760 |
| Research Associate | 1 | $56,892 |
| Research Assistant Professor | 1 | $75,000 |
| Project Coordinator | 1 | $52,416 |
| Health Informatics Analyst | 1 | $95,004 |
| Data Analyst | 1 | $45,972 |
| Business Intelligence Developer | 1 | $100,560 |
| Adjunct Assistant Professor | 1 | $79,997 |
